Update index.md
This commit is contained in:
parent
ef535bb677
commit
b1233f5912
@ -4,20 +4,35 @@ layout: default
|
|||||||
|
|
||||||
# Defold In-app purchase extension API documentation
|
# Defold In-app purchase extension API documentation
|
||||||
|
|
||||||
This extension provides functions for making in-app purchases. Supported on iOS, Android (Google Play and Amazon) and Facebook Canvas. On Google Play the extension supports Billing 3.0.
|
This extension provides functions for making in-app purchases.
|
||||||
|
|
||||||
# Usage
|
|
||||||
To use this library in your Defold project, add the following URL to your <code class="inline-code-block">game.project</code> dependencies:
|
## Usage
|
||||||
|
To use this library in your Defold project, add the following URL to your `game.project` dependencies:
|
||||||
|
|
||||||
https://github.com/defold/extension-iap/archive/master.zip
|
https://github.com/defold/extension-iap/archive/master.zip
|
||||||
|
|
||||||
We recommend using a link to a zip file of a [specific release](https://github.com/defold/extension-iap/releases).
|
We recommend using a link to a zip file of a [specific release](https://github.com/defold/extension-iap/releases).
|
||||||
|
|
||||||
|
For Facebook Canvas you also need to add the [Facebook extension as a dependency](https://github.com/defold/extension-facebook).
|
||||||
|
|
||||||
|
|
||||||
## Source code
|
## Source code
|
||||||
|
|
||||||
The source code is available on [GitHub](https://github.com/defold/extension-iap)
|
The source code is available on [GitHub](https://github.com/defold/extension-iap)
|
||||||
|
|
||||||
## Differences between supported platforms
|
|
||||||
|
## Supported platforms
|
||||||
|
|
||||||
|
The following platforms are supported by the extension:
|
||||||
|
|
||||||
|
* iOS - StoreKit
|
||||||
|
* Google Play - Billing 3.0.0
|
||||||
|
* Amazon - 2.0.61
|
||||||
|
* Facebook Canvas
|
||||||
|
|
||||||
|
|
||||||
|
### Differences between supported platforms
|
||||||
|
|
||||||
Amazon supports two different product types: subscriptions and consumable products.
|
Amazon supports two different product types: subscriptions and consumable products.
|
||||||
|
|
||||||
@ -29,7 +44,7 @@ Calls to `iap.buy()` and `iap.set_listener()` will return all non-finished purch
|
|||||||
|
|
||||||
The concept of restoring purchases does not exist on Google Play/Amazon. Calls to `iap.restore()` on iOS will return all purchased products (and have product state set to TRANS_STATE_RESTORED). Calls to `iap.restore()` on Google Play will return all non-finished purchases (and have product state set to TRANS_STATE_PURCHASED).
|
The concept of restoring purchases does not exist on Google Play/Amazon. Calls to `iap.restore()` on iOS will return all purchased products (and have product state set to TRANS_STATE_RESTORED). Calls to `iap.restore()` on Google Play will return all non-finished purchases (and have product state set to TRANS_STATE_PURCHASED).
|
||||||
|
|
||||||
###
|
---
|
||||||
|
|
||||||
# API reference
|
# API reference
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user